RISD math vocab. 1st 9 weeks
| Math Vocabulary | Definition |
|---|---|
| product | the answer to a multiplication problem |
| sum | the answer in an addition problem |
| difference | the answer in a subtraction problem |
| quotient | the answer in a division problem |
| divisor | the number used to divide another number |
| dividend | the number to be divided in a division problem |
| factors | the numbers that are multiplied to get a product |
| prime number | a number whose only factors are itself and one |
| exponent | a number telling how many times a number is to be used as a factor |
| estimate | to get an approximate answer to a problem |
| decline | to go down or diminish |
| X axis | the orizontal number line on a coordinate grid |
| Y axis | the vertical number line on a coordinate grid |
| ordered pairs | a pair of numbers used to locate a point on a coordinate grid |
| short word form | a number written with both numerals and words |
| expanded notation | writing a number to show the value of each digit |
| standard form | a number written with commas separating groups of three numbers |
| median | the middle number in data that is arranged in order from least to greatest |
| mean | the average; the sum of numbers in a set divided by the number of addends |
| mode | the number found most frequently in a set of data |
| range | the difference between the greatest number and the least number in a set of data |
| data | facts, figures, or information that is gathered |
| tally | a mark made to keep score or count |
| frequency | how often a number appears in a set of data |
| pictograph | a graph that used pictures or symbols to represent numbers |
| histogram | a bar graph showing frequency of data |
| stem and leaf plot | a display that shows data in order of place value |
| line graph | a graph that uses lines to show change |
| double bar graph | a graph that uses pairs of bars to compare information |
| frequency table | data arranged on a table to show how often events occur |
| numerator | the number above the fraction bar |
| denominator | the number below the fraction bar |
| mixed number | a number that includes a whole number and a fractional part |
| equivalent fraction | fractions that name the same fractional number |
| improper fraction | a fraction where the numerator is greater than or equal to the denominator; naming a number of one or more |
| variable | a symbol used to represent numbers in an expression |
| expression | a mathematical phrase made up of a combination of variables, numbers and/or numbers and operations |
| equation | a mathematical sentence which states that 2 expressions are equal |
